Scheduled Weekend Maintenance: Keeping Your Workstation Secure and Optimized

Technology Services – Student Affairs is making changes to our weekend maintenance policy. Starting January 17th, 2026, a new weekly maintenance window will be introduced during which all managed workstations will receive scheduled updates and restarts every Friday and Saturday at midnight.

To ensure your workstation remains reliable, secure, and performing at its best, Technology Services – Student Affairs is introducing a new weekly maintenance window.

Starting this weekend, and continuing every Friday and Saturday at midnight, all managed workstations will undergo scheduled updates and restarts.

How to Prepare Each Friday

To ensure these updates are successful and to protect your work, please complete the following steps before leaving for the weekend:

  1. Save Your Work: These updates include a forced restart. Please ensure all documents and applications are saved and closed to prevent any data loss.
  2. Stay Powered On: Our network cannot “wake up” a computer that is off. Please leave your workstation powered on and awake (disable “Sleep” mode if possible).
  3. Check Your Connection:
    • On-Campus: Simply leave your device plugged into the network.
    • Off-Campus (Cisco AnyConnect users): If your device is not managed by DSA and you utilize Cisco AnyConnect, please ensure your VPN is connected so your device can receive the necessary security patches.

What to Expect

  • Timing: Restarts occur at midnight on Friday and Saturday.
  • Experience: If you happen to be working during these times, you may notice restart dialogue boxes on screen, brief interruptions or multiple restarts.
  • Ready for Tuesday: Once this initial maintenance window closes, your computer will be updated and fully ready for your return on Tuesday morning, January 20th.

Why are we doing this?

Regular restarts are the most effective way to clear out system “clutter,” apply critical security patches, and ensure that your software tools run without lag during your busy work week.
